The through-line
Every engagement is a version of the same problem: a domain too complicated for the people inside it to see whole, and software that made it worse rather than better.
The method hasn't changed much. Model the domain before designing the interface. Find where the real constraint lives it's almost never where the complaint is. Build the thing, watch people use it, and measure whether they can do the work better.
That last part matters more than it probably should. We don't measure success by engagement or time-on-task. We measure it by whether someone can do their job better than they could before.

What's different about AI work
Applied AI hasn't changed the method; it's raised the stakes on getting it right. A traditional system fails visibly. An AI system fails plausibly it produces something confident and wrong, and unless you've built the instrumentation to catch it, you find out from a customer.
So the discipline is the same discipline, applied harder: understand the domain, define precisely what correct means, build the measurement before you build the trust.
